Weight loss is a topic rife with misconceptions. Let’s clear the air by debunking some common myths and addressing a critical question: “How many calories should I eat to lose weight?”

1. Myth: All Calories Are Equal

A calorie from a doughnut is not the same as a calorie from an apple. Nutrient-dense foods provide essential nutrients and keep you full longer. For instance, proteins and complex carbohydrates offer more satiety and nutritional benefits compared to sugary or fatty foods. This distinction is crucial for effective weight management.

2. Myth: Skipping Meals Helps You Lose Weight

Skipping meals can lead to a slower metabolism and increased cravings, often resulting in overeating later. It’s more effective to eat balanced meals and snacks throughout the day to maintain steady blood sugar levels and prevent hunger-driven binge eating.

3. Myth: You Can Spot Reduce Fat

Spot reduction, or losing fat from a specific body part, is a myth. Fat loss occurs throughout the body as a whole. A combination of cardiovascular exercise, strength training, and a healthy diet helps reduce overall body fat, including in problem areas.

4. Myth: Carbs Are the Enemy

Carbohydrates are often unfairly blamed for weight gain. The key is to choose complex carbohydrates like whole grains, legumes, and vegetables, which provide sustained energy and essential nutrients. These foods help regulate blood sugar levels and prevent overeating.

5. Myth: Exercise Alone Is Enough

While exercise is essential for maintaining a healthy weight, it must be combined with a balanced diet for optimal results. Exercise burns calories and builds muscle, but consuming more calories than you burn can hinder weight loss efforts.

How Many Calories Should You Eat to Lose Weight?

To lose weight, creating a calorie deficit is essential. This means consuming fewer calories than you burn. It’s crucial to approach weight loss healthily and sustainably, ensuring you get adequate nutrients.
